Weather in July

July, like June, is a hot summer month in Bonuan, Philippines, with an average temperature varying between 24.3°C (75.7°F) and 30.9°C (87.6°F).

Temperature

As July takes hold, the average high-temperature is a still hot 30.9°C (87.6°F), nearly mirroring that of the previous month. In Bonuan, July nights witness a steady temperature drop to a warm 24.3°C (75.7°F).

Heat index

In July, the heat index is evaluated at a blistering 41°C (105.8°F). More protective measures are required - heat exhaustion and heat cramps are likely. Heatstroke may follow lengthy activity.
Take into consideration that the heat index values are calculated for shade and light wind conditions. With direct sunlight, the heat index could increase by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'real feel' or 'apparent temperature', is a measure that combines air temperature and relative humidity into a single value that indicates how hot the weather feels. Elements of metabolic variation, physical activity, and clothing contribute to the effect of temperature on an individual. It is noteworthy to mention that direct sunlight exposure can augment the felt temperature, leading to an increase in the heat index by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are highly important for children. Kids are usually in more danger than grown-ups as they tend to sweat less. Plus, their bigger skin surface in relation to their small frames and increased heat generation due to their activity level make them more susceptible.
Perspiration is essential for the human body; it facilitates cooling through the process of sweat evaporation. When there is abundant moisture in the air, the body's cooling through the evaporation process becomes less effective, leading to the sensation of overheating. Rising body temperatures due to excess heat retention could signify impending heat disorders.

Humidity

The average relative humidity in July in Bonuan is 81%.

Rainfall

In July, the rain falls for 28.4 days. Throughout July, 216mm (8.5") of precipitation is accumulated. In Bonuan, Philippines, during the entire year, the rain falls for 187.6 days and collects up to 1079mm (42.48") of precipitation.

Daylight

In Bonuan, Philippines, the average length of the day in July is 12h and 59min.
On the first day of the month, sunrise is at 5:30 am and sunset at 6:34 pm. On the last day of July, in Bonuan, sunrise is at 5:39 am and sunset at 6:30 pm PST.

Sunshine

In Bonuan, the average sunshine in July is 9.4h.

A UV Index value of 6 to 7 symbolizes a high health hazard from exposure to the Sun's UV radiation for average individuals.
Note: In July, a regular UV index of 7 translates into these guidelines:
Evade overexposure. Individuals with fair skin risk burning in under 20 minutes. The time between 10 a.m. and 4 p.m. is when UV radiation is at its peak. Limit exposure to direct sunlight during these hours. Shield yourself from the harmful effects of UV radiation with sun-protective attire, a hat, and quality sunglasses.
